通过sql查询出的某个字段的值为一条SQL语句,我应该如何让获取这个sql的值
select字段1from表名查询出来字段1为一条sql语句,而上面sql语句中我想查询出来字段1为这条sql语句的值。...
select 字段1 from 表名
查询出来字段1为一条sql语句,而上面sql语句中我想查询出来字段1为这条sql语句的值。 展开
查询出来字段1为一条sql语句,而上面sql语句中我想查询出来字段1为这条sql语句的值。 展开
4个回答
展开全部
declare @sql_str nvarchar
select @sql_str=字段1 from xx
这样变量就获得了sql字符串
select @sql_str=字段1 from xx
这样变量就获得了sql字符串
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
拼动态SQL啊,写存储过程
追问
第一想直接通过sql完成,第二是不是写,求大神写出来
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
create table A
(
name varchar(1000)
)
insert into A
select 'select * from T_ZZ_Menu'
declare @lssql nvarchar(1000)
select @lssql=name from A
exec(@lssql)
(
name varchar(1000)
)
insert into A
select 'select * from T_ZZ_Menu'
declare @lssql nvarchar(1000)
select @lssql=name from A
exec(@lssql)
本回答被提问者和网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
是不是你现在需要条件需要一条sql返回的值啊
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询